Abstract :
This article presents a study on failure criteria applied to wood, specifically the criteria of Hill, Tsai-Hill, Tsai-Wu, Hoffman and Norris. The theoretical basis of the research involves a development from the conventional failure theory with an application to orthotropic materials. Thus, an analysis of failure criteria was performed, in particular the failure envelope curve achievement from the mechanical properties of two Brazilian wood species, Pinus elliotti and Goupia glabra. A comparison between the obtained envelopes curves with experimental results, which were obtained from biaxial compressive tests, shear tests and off-axis uniaxial tests, was performed to evaluate the analyzed criteria. In general, the Hoffman criterion presented the best result for strength evaluation of these wood species.
